A few of these services have been described in the following. One of the services, which offer by international banks, is the earn of credit service. This service is basically provided in the cases of products or services that purchase by individuals or organizations from the international banks. In relation to this particular service, the banks issue a document, which acts as an assurance of payment to the seller of the goods or the services, even if the buying individuals or organizations fail to comply with the payment process. It would be vital to mention that the banks issuing the letter of credit document will certainly make the buyers liable for making payments to the sellers.
